Personal Life

Tems is a British-Nigerian singer and songwriter born in Lagos on June 11, 1995, to a British father and a Nigerian mother. Her parents got separated when she was five, so she was raised by her mum. She attended Bowen College in Lekki and then studied Economics at a University in Johannesburg, South Africa.

Career

Tems started music at age 11 when she joined her school choir and started music production when she was 20. She released her first single ‘Mr. Rebel’ in 2018. She also released her hit single ‘Try Me’. Try Me became a popular hit track and has over 3.8 million views on YouTube. She was recruited that year by American singer Khalid to join him and fellow Nigerian singer Davido on an Afrobeats remix of Know Your Worth in 2020.

She was named as one of ‘ten artists to watch’ by DJ Edu.

Trivia

In December 2020, Tems was arrested alongside her manager, Muyiwa Awoniyi, and fellow singer, Omah Lay, for violating Covid-19 regulations by performing in a concert in Uganda.
